AXIS#.MOTOR.BRAKE
Description
The AXIS#.MOTOR.BRAKE parameter notifies the firmware whether a brake exists or not. It does not apply or release the brake. If a brake is found to be present, the firmware considers hardware indications regarding the brake circuits (such as open circuit or short circuit). If a brake does not exist, then the firmware ignores the hardware indications since they are irrelevant.

When the axis is enabled, setting AXIS#.MOTOR.BRAKE to 1 when no motor brake exists creates a fault.
-
-
This parameter is automatically configured for Kollmorgen motors when AXIS#.MOTOR.AUTOSET=1 and motor memory version is 0.2 or greater. This parameter can be modified while AXIS#.MOTOR.AUTOSET = 1 if its AXIS#.MOTOR.DISAUTOSET index =1.
